Carl Suggs, age 79, of 401 Third Street Extension, Vienna, died Sunday, October 17, 2010, at his residence. Born in Lanier County, he was the son of the late William Allen Suggs and Mary Rebecca Skinner Suggs. Mr. Suggs retired from John Pitts Construction Company and was the owner of Suggs Trucking Co. He was a member of Pinehurst Baptist Church. Mr. Suggs loved NASCAR and Bluegrass, but his greatest love was his family. Survivors include: Wife: Carolyn Weeks Suggs of Vienna Sons: Greg Suggs (Karen) of Vienna Louie Suggs (Carmen) of Phoenix, AZ Gerald Suggs of Orlando, FL Daughters: Diane Brannen (Rodney) of Vienna Rhonda Barnes (Bruce) of Lake Park Melissa Fore of Cordele Rebecca Rampey (Steve) of Lakeland Donna Kay Futch (Jeff) of Nashville Brother: Junior Allen Suggs of Lakeland Sister: Mary Bell Palmer (Junior) of Ray City Grandchildren: 18 Great Grandchildren: 10 He is also survived by a special family member, Chris Johnson of Vienna. Funeral services will be at 11 AM Wednesday, October 20 in Vienna United Methodist Church with interment in Vienna City Cemetery. The family will greet friends 6 - 8 PM Tuesday, October 19 at the funeral home. Memorial gifts may be made to United Hospice, 708 East 16th Avenue, Cordele, GA 31015. Brannen-NeSmith Funeral Home of Vienna has charge of arrangements.
